1. Choose an outdoor pizza oven
There are actually a number of different options for you to choose from. In our case, you’ve got the Alfresco Pizza Oven, the Lynx Pizza Oven, the Pacific Living and the Sole Gourmet.
The Alfresco Pizza Oven actually does more than cook pizzas. If you were at all concerned about pigeon-holing your luxury backyard into a pizza-themed lounge, then fear no more. These are some of the other things the Alfresco Pizza Oven can do:
- Baking
- Broiling
- Roasting
- Re-heating leftovers in style
The Lynx Pizza Oven is a movable appliance that you can adjust to your stylistic whims. Its stainless-steel exterior will match any pre-existing patio ensemble you’ve got going on. There’s storage and an extension that’ll hold all the utensils you’re juggling to make the perfect pizza.
The Pacific Living Pizza Oven is another all-purpose oven that’ll fulfill all your ADD cooking fantasies. It also has a stainless-steel exterior, but its shape brings to mind “time machine” more so than it does “oven.” Get it if you want to make pizzas for (and, possibly, from) your future parties.
The Sole Gourmet Pizza Oven is the perfect oven to choose if you were worried about taking up too much space in your backyard. The Sole Gourmet has a sleek, simple design that’s totally unobtrusive.
